Output 70cc075e2cc48ca2c7a048fd392b669d5593c822ead7c86b1b3707ef28acb131:0

value
94722038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14a18e8d4eee44765c1784a4c41e912650699866 OP_EQUAL
address
2Mu8K3HbDigV8acs4EBJKmSFupXPYfWiK3k
transaction
70cc075e2cc48ca2c7a048fd392b669d5593c822ead7c86b1b3707ef28acb131
confirmations
21018
spent
true